Renaissance Movie Review: An Inside Look at Beyoncé's Groundbreaking Concert Film
Beyoncé solidifies her status as one of the greatest living entertainers and most innovative filmmakers in Renaissance, her new concert documentary. This riveting book goes behind-the-scenes of the 2022 Renaissance World Tour and film, showcasing the tireless work required to pull off pop spectacle at this unprecedented scale.
Through exclusive interviews and highlights, you will gain insight into Beyoncé's creative vision as both a perfectionist artist and compassionate leader guiding a diverse creative team. We witness the incredible choreography, fashion, music production, set design, and directing that converge each night at peak brilliance. But also the grueling labor, tough decisions, and obstacles overcome through resilience and camaraderie behind-the-curtains.
Beyond the glamour, Renaissance spotlights the marginalized communities whose influence roots Beyoncé's artistry, including trailblazing ballroom houses, trans artists, and her late uncle's queer lineage. By ceding these collaborators space to shine, Beyoncé presents a masterclass in ethical artistic practice and grace.
Ultimately this visually stunning book immortalizes a pivotal career juncture for both musician and filmmaker, recently embracing more unbridled confidence and creativity after years of compromise. It's a rare backstage pass into the making of history by one of music's greatest living forces at the height of her powers. Renaissance sets concert films alight to inspire for generations.
